Which factor is crucial when determining the flow rate of natural gas in a piping network?

Explanation:
Determining the flow rate of natural gas in a piping network requires consideration of multiple factors that each play a significant role in the overall calculation. The diameter of the pipe directly affects the volume of gas that can flow through it; larger diameters allow greater flow rates due to decreased resistance. The length of the pipe also matters, as longer pipes can increase the frictional losses, which may reduce the effective flow rate. Additionally, the specific gravity of the gas is critical because it affects the density and, consequently, how pressure and temperature variations will influence the behavior of the gas within the piping system. Each of these factors—pipe diameter, pipe length, and specific gravity—contributes to the complexities of gas flow in a system.
